一.安装环境配置我是在ubuntu13.10下进行配置的。
1.首先安装ssh.
$ sudo apt-get install ssh
2.安装java
在配置hadoop安装环境时,我们需要的jdk为sun jdk,而ubuntu自带的jdk通常为open jdk.我们通过首先查看jdk类型。
1)从官网上下载jdk安装包。
2)进入jdk所在目录
更改文件权限
安装jdk
3)配置环境变量
sudo gedit /etc/profile
打开profile文件,在最下方输入文件并保存。
cd
重新启动终端,输入java -version 查看java版本。
如果出现以下提示,
*openjdk-6-jre-headless
*sunjdk-8-jre
*openjdk-7-jre
表示系统没有设置默认的jdk,执行以下3条命令:
bi
执行完之后,输入java -version 提示以下信息,表示jdk安装成功。
则表示安装成功。
3.下载并解压Hadoop安装包
从官网上下载hadoop安装包,并解压。
4.更改文件路径和配置信息
a.把hadoop-0.20.2/conf/hadoop-env.xml中的JAVA_HOME设为jdk所在路径。因为在hadoop、mapreduce编译和运行时需要用到jvm.
b.修改文件配置信息与hadoop三种模式的关系
更改完毕之后,将身份切换到root下。
5.测试hadoop是否就绪可用
1).格式化NameNode
2)启动Hadoop(包括HDFS,NameNode,DataNode)
3)键入命令jps(jps是JVM检查进程状态的工具),若已经全部成功,则输出:
以上为伪分布式截图。
以上则配置过程全部完成。
Hadoop安装与编程(一)——安装部分,布布扣,bubuko.com
原文:http://www.cnblogs.com/timesdaughter/p/3667243.html